A guesthouse-style property nestled on a quiet hillside in Kamakura. Guests most frequently mention the home-like atmosphere and warm hospitality.
Reviews repeatedly highlight the family-run service, thoughtfully prepared meals, views of Mt. Fuji, cleanliness, and peaceful surroundings. The hosts offer pickup and drop-off from the station, which guests appreciate.
Some note that the final approach road is unpaved and under construction, making access tricky by car. The location is a little removed from central Kamakura, so arranging transport in advance is recommended.
Best suited for couples or families seeking a quiet stay who either have a car or are comfortable using the shuttle service.
